六、阅读短文并回答问题。
I’ll always remember that day,when I was so surprised by all the strange looks everyone was giving me. Those thoughts will always stay with me. And I couldn’t believe I would lose the friendship of the person I trusted the most.
Five years back,Sally was the new kid in class. She was the most friendly person I knew. We started as classmates,but after a few months,we were like best friends. So,I never expected her to hurt me in such a big way.
I don’t know what made me tell Sally about my personal life—a thirteen-year-old girl’s life. She made the matter bigger than it was,telling everyone at school. It was like someone had hit me in the back. After she gave away my secrets,everyone at school started laughing at me,looking at me whenever I passed by. After this terrible situation,I changed schools. Sally called me many times,but I didn’t answer. My heart was broken.
I tried hard to heal(康复) from the scars(伤疤) she left on my heart. I started a new life. After five years,my life went back to the way it was,with new friends. But one day,I met Anna at the market. She was my classmate from the 3rd grade. She told me that Sally wasn’t the one who brought my secrets to light. Mary was. Mary was our school’s big mouth who always wanted to stick her nose into other people’s business.
I didn’t know what to do. I wished I could have asked Sally about this. I wished I could go back in time and fix my mistakes. From that,I learned a life lesson that we should trust those we love because one little mistake could really damage(破坏) our lives.
1. Why did the writer make friends with Sally?
2. What did the writer do after her secrets were given away?
3. When did the writer’s life go back to the way it was?
4. Who brought the writer’s secrets to light?
5. What lesson did the writer learn from the experience?
